KJV Lexicon κατανοησας verb - aorist active participle - nominative singular masculine katanoeo kat-an-o-eh'-o: to observe fully -- behold, consider, discover, perceive. δε conjunction de deh: but, and, etc. -- also, and, but, moreover, now (often unexpressed in English). αυτων personal pronoun - genitive plural masculine autos ow-tos': the reflexive pronoun self, used of the third person , and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ons την definite article - accusative singular feminine ho ho: the definite article; the (sometimes to be supplied, at others omitted, in English idiom) -- the, this, that, one, he, she, it, etc. πανουργιαν noun - accusative singular feminine panourgia pan-oorg-ee'-ah: adroitness, i.e. (in a bad sense) trickery or sophistry -- (cunning) craftiness, subtilty. ειπεν verb - second aorist active indicative - third person singular epo ep'-o: to speak or say (by word or writing) -- answer, bid, bring word, call, command, grant, say (on), speak, tell. προς preposition pros pros: a preposition of direction; forward to, i.e. toward αυτους personal pronoun - accusative plural masculine autos ow-tos': the reflexive pronoun self, used of the third person , and (with the proper personal pronoun) of the other persons τι interrogative pronoun - accusative singular neuter tis tis: an interrogative pronoun, who, which or what (in direct or indirect questions) -- every man, how (much), + no(-ne, thing), what (manner, thing), where (-by, -fore, -of, -unto, -with, -withal), whether, which, who(-m, -se), why. με personal pronoun - first person accusative singular me meh: me -- I, me, my. πειραζετε verb - present active indicative - second person peirazo pi-rad'-zo: to test (objectively), i.e. endeavor, scrutinize, entice, discipline -- assay, examine, go about, prove, tempt(-er), try. Parallel Verses New American Standard Bible But He detected their trickery and said to them, King James Bible But he perceived their craftiness, and said unto them, Why tempt ye me? Holman Christian Standard Bible But detecting their craftiness, He said to them, International Standard Version But he discerned their craftiness and responded to them, NET Bible But Jesus perceived their deceit and said to them, Aramaic Bible in Plain English “But he perceived their cunning and he said, “Why are you testing me?” GOD'S WORD® Translation He saw through their scheme, so he said to them, King James 2000 Bible But he perceived their craftiness, and said unto them, Why do you test me?
